Oracle對兩個數據表交集的查詢建站知識
導讀:1建站知識Oracle對兩個數據表交集的查詢seo網站優化百度seo網站優化。
正在看的ORACLE教程是:Oracle對兩個數據表交集的查詢。
Oracle關系型數據庫管理系統是世界上流行的關系數據庫,它是一個極其強大、靈活和復雜的系統,據說,在使用oracle時應有這樣的思想,那就是在SQL中幾乎可以實現任何一seo網站優化軟件種想法。 下面向大家介紹使用SQL查兩個Oracle數據表查詢的相同數據的方法,筆者感到這兩種方法執行效率高、網站seo優化課程使用方便。 第一種方法:利用操作符intersect intersect操作符用來合并兩個查詢,返回兩個查詢中都存在的記錄,即返回兩個查詢結果的交集,前提是兩個查詢的列的數量和數據類型必須完全相同。 舉例說明: 表A的數據結構: 表B的數據結構: 表A的數據為: ('1101 ','韓甲'),('1102 ','丁乙') 表B的數據為: ('1101 ','韓甲',99),('1102 ','丁乙',89),('1103 ','徐網站seo優化培訓靜',94) 在oracle中運行以下查詢,圖1顯示了這個查詢的結果:
[NextPage] 第二種方法: in子句 in子句可以在子查詢中為where子句計算所得的值創建一個列表。這種方法與前一種方法有所不同的是,前一種方法比較多列但只使用一個intersect就行了,而一個in子句用來比較兩個子查詢的一列,比較幾列就要使用幾個in子句。下面舉例說明如何取得兩個查詢的交集。 仍以A和B兩張數據表為例,在oracle中運行以下查詢,圖2顯示了這個查詢的結果: 查詢結果如圖2所示。 以上為筆者使用oracle7.3的體會,如有不當之處,請不吝賜教。
上一頁
相關seo網站優化百度seo網站優化。聲明: 本文由我的SEOUC技術文章主頁發布于:2023-05-22 ,文章Oracle對兩個數據表交集的查詢建站知識主要講述數據表,兩個,Oracle對兩個數據表交集的查詢建站知網站建設源碼以及服務器配置搭建相關技術文章。轉載請保留鏈接: http://www.bifwcx.com/article/web_5006.html